I’m building a new trophy bass pond. About 2.5 acres. I have electric close by. What would be the best aeration setup? I’ve included plans for the new build.
You will need a ventilated enclosure for your compressor. It will make some noise - and my wife hates "white noise" when she is trying to enjoy the peace and quiet of the great outdoors (interesting animal sounds excluded).
Is there a good place for you to set your enclosure away from the places where people sleep, eat with family, or just relax? If so, I would set the enclosure near an easy electrical connection that is handy for you to check in your normal routine, but away from "people". Running a few extra feet of polyethylene air pipeline is pretty darn cheap at current prices.

There are "sound kits" that are available from different mfg's for their enclosures to knock down the compressor noise. Vertex Aquatic Solutions has done dB testing on their systems with and without the sound kits installed. That's the only aeration mfg that I know of that has done that. My "ventilated enclosure" is a 6'x8' pole barn construction shed, with forced air cooling (from the North side of the shed) for the compressor as well as storage for fishing gear, canoe paddles, and more. The noise outside is much reduced compared to a naked compressor (and more so since I have insulated the shed. If you might want an "oarhouse" next to your pond, it is an option to consider.
Based on the bottom structural configurations. Uneven deviations from the basic bottom bowl shape will tend to restrict the affects of the aeration water patterns. This I think means more bottom based aerator diffusers will be needed to get effective circulations to all areas of the deeper pond basin. To my thinking I would have at least 4 bottom diffusers and better to have 6 or 7. The cross ridge hump side should have 3 maybe 4 diffusers. Then put 3 of the other side of the pond. A 3/4 hp rotary vane with 10 cfm open flow will operate 6-8 diffusers. Done right with strong circulations IMO you would only need to run the compressor 6-8 hrs per day to adequately circulate deep water areas (7ft & deeper) to the surface. I tested my minnow pond (10ft deep) that has no aerator yesterday. Water was mixing with wind circulation and good oxygenation down to 7 ft deep. Water clarity this year so far 2-2.5ft.
